For CEOs like you aiming for killer mobile apps, the real grind is not hiring mobile app developers in London, UK—it’s about finding the right ones. While initiating Mobile App Development, you need a talent that ticks all the boxes: technical brilliance, cost-effectiveness, and a competitive knack for aligning with your business vision.
According to Hyve Managed Hosting’s ‘IT and Tech Skills Gap Report 2024’, 81% of UK businesses have been negatively impacted by a shortage of skilled IT and tech professionals.
Reality check – The tech hiring landscape is brimmed with countless developers who talk the talk, but can they walk the walk? Can the resources you hire strike the perfect equilibrium between quality, speed, and cost? Are they scalable for your futuristic goals?
Whether you’re eyeing an in-house crew, an outsourced dedicated app development team, or a super-skilled freelancer, this blog cuts through the noise. It helps you suss out the best Mobile App Developers in the United Kingdom.
Finding the right mobile app developers in London is essential for turning your app idea into a successful product. This guide will give you result-driven tips to hire mobile app developers in London.
Begin by clearly outlining your app’s purpose, target audience, core functionalities, and unique selling points. A well-defined scope helps UK mobile app developers understand your vision and ensures alignment.
Break down features into must-haves and nice-to-haves to prioritize effectively. When exploring ways to hire mobile app developers in the UK, ensure you focus on developers with experience that aligns with your app’s specific needs and functionalities.
For example, if you’re building a food delivery app, your requirements might include real-time GPS tracking, multiple payment options, user account management, and a user-friendly voice user interface.
Determine the best development path based on your app’s purpose, desired user experience, and budget. Choosing between native, cross-platform, and web apps can have significant impacts on performance, development time, and cost:
Carefully evaluate these options to align with your project needs when you hire mobile app developers in the UK.
Establish a realistic mobile app development budget and timeline, factoring in the complexity of your app and possible unexpected changes to work seamlessly with the best mobile app developers in the United Kingdom. Outline a budget range with flexibility for adjustments and set clear milestones to track progress over time.
Account for mobile app testing, updates, and post-launch support, as these can affect costs and deadlines. Building in buffer time and a contingency budget will help you navigate any unforeseen delays smoothly.
Explore reputable mobile app developers for your custom project in London by researching online platforms such as GoodFirms and LinkedIn or by seeking recommendations.
When you hire mobile app developers in London, UK, deciding between hiring freelancers, agencies, or a dedicated in-house team is essential, each offering distinct advantages and challenges. Ensure that the UK mobile app developers you shortlist have experience in projects similar to yours.
Digital innovation and portfolio transformation analysis are crucial to assess their design aesthetic, technical skills, and versatility across different industries. Look for projects that mirror your app’s scope, complexity, or audience to understand how well they execute relevant features. A portfolio with a range of well-executed projects shows their adaptability and commitment to quality when you hire mobile app developers in the UK.
Client testimonials and reviews provide insights into the developer’s reliability, communication, and delivery track record. Explore reviews on trusted sites like Clutch or Google Business, and reach out to previous clients when possible.
Reliable reviews will show the developer’s ability to stick to timelines, handle challenges, and work collaboratively. Focus on feedback related to responsiveness, professionalism, and flexibility—qualities essential to hiring mobile app developers in the UK.
Your developers’ technical knowledge should match your project’s technical requirements, including the latest programming languages, mobile app development frameworks, and tools. Ensure they are proficient in:
Also, confirm their experience dealing with API Development, databases, cloud computing services, and UI/UX in the app development process and best practices to ensure they can bring your vision to life smoothly.
Once you have shortlisted the resources, conduct in-depth interviews to gauge each developer’s understanding of your project and problem-solving skills. Pay attention to how they approach challenges and ask clarifying questions.
For technical assessment, consider assigning a relevant task or coding challenge that reflects real project scenarios to evaluate firsthand the expertise of the best mobile app developers in the United Kingdom.
When discussing terms, ensure pricing aligns with your budget and clarify all elements covered in the contract, including development milestones, post-launch support, and update cycles. Negotiating a well-structured contract with transparent terms and payment schedules helps prevent misunderstandings, establishes mutual trust, and simplifies hiring mobile app developers in the UK.
Ensure UK mobile app developers comply with data privacy laws, such as GDPR-compliant software development and other legal requirements specific to your industry and region. This step is crucial for safeguarding user data and avoiding potential legal risks. Verify that your contract includes intellectual property terms to guarantee your ownership of the app’s code and assets.
Effective communication is key to a successful partnership. Set up weekly or bi-weekly check-ins to discuss progress, feedback, and any challenges. Decide on communication tools (like Slack, Trello, or email) and ensure both parties agree on a responsive, collaborative approach. This consistency helps keep your project on track, fosters a transparent working environment, and supports efforts to hire mobile app developers in the UK.
You may like reading: How much does it cost to build a FinTech app in the UK?
Choosing the right development team is a pivotal decision in mobile app development. Businesses can opt for in-house development, outsourcing, or hiring freelancers.
Each option offers distinct approaches tailored to various business needs and resources. Let’s explore how these options differ and what they bring.
In-house development involves creating a dedicated team within your organization. You can hire mobile app developers in London, UK, to strengthen this team, ensuring seamless collaboration, alignment with your values, and efficient app development.
Building an internal technical team is ideal for companies with ongoing development needs, requiring substantial investment in infrastructure and personnel.
This model suits organizations with a long-term vision for app evolution. This approach ensures sustained technical growth and expertise for businesses looking to hire mobile developers or work with top app developers in the UK.
Pros:
Cons:
Outsourcing app development connects businesses with skilled professionals worldwide. You can hire mobile app developers in London, UK, to execute complex ideas with advanced tools and methodologies for localized expertise.
This model offers flexibility, allowing businesses to scale teams as needed while focusing on core operations.
Outsourcing to mobile app developers in the United Kingdom ensures efficient development, faster delivery, and end-to-end services, including post-launch support, to optimize your app. Companies opting for outsourcing often find it a strategic move that enhances quality and time-to-market.
Pros:
Cons:
Also Read: In-House or Outsourcing: Which is Better for App Development?
Freelancers offer a flexible approach to app development, ideal for businesses needing specific expertise or working on smaller projects.
These independent professionals are typically hired for their specialized skills, such as UI/UX design, front-end coding, or app testing.
This option suits businesses testing app ideas or needing specific skills for short-term tasks. You can also hire mobile app developers in London, UK, to complement your existing team and ensure efficient project execution.
Pros:
Cons:
Outstaffing allows you to hire mobile app developers in London as part of your existing team, giving you control over project management while the outstaffing provider handles HR and legal aspects.
Developers typically charge $40 to $70 per hour, making it a cost-effective option for businesses needing to scale quickly without committing to full-time hires.
Pros:
Cons:
Full outsourcing involves hiring an agency or development company in London to manage the entire app development process, from planning to deployment.
This model is ideal for businesses lacking technical expertise, with rates ranging from $50 to $90 per hour. It provides access to experienced teams and ensures quality but offers less direct control.
Pros:
Cons:
A dedicated development team gives you access to a group of developers in London who work exclusively on your project, providing consistent collaboration and expertise.
This hiring model is ideal for long-term, complex projects, with hourly rates typically ranging from $45 to $80. It combines flexibility with a strong focus on achieving project goals.
Pros:
Cons:
Learn: How to hire a dedicated development team?
Hiring a mobile app developer in London typically costs $60 to $150 per hour or more, influenced by expertise, project complexity, and platform requirements. The cost of hiring a mobile app developer in London depends on various factors, from the project’s complexity to the developer’s expertise and the platform requirements.
Here are some key factors to consider when hiring mobile app developers in London, UK. These include the developer’s expertise, the complexity of the project, and the chosen hiring model, each significantly influencing costs and timelines. Understanding these factors helps businesses make informed decisions and find the right talent.
Experienced mobile application developers in the UK bring a wealth of knowledge and problem-solving abilities, ensuring efficient handling of challenges during development.
While junior developers may provide basic skills, senior developers excel in implementing advanced technologies and methodologies, which can significantly affect the project’s progress and outcomes.
The scope and intricacy of the app are pivotal in determining the level of effort required. Simple apps with basic features demand less time, while those involving advanced functionalities, real-time data handling, or multi-user capabilities require more extensive planning and development.
Choosing between iOS, Android, or both platforms directly influences the development effort. Native development typically requires separate coding for each platform, while cross-platform solutions streamline the process, allowing a single codebase to serve multiple platforms effectively.
Incorporating features such as AI-powered recommendations, secure payment gateways, or geolocation services adds value to the app but requires significant technical expertise and resources. The more innovative and tailored the features, the greater the development effort involved.
The time required to complete the project is a critical factor. Longer development timelines may necessitate sustained resources, while shorter deadlines could involve intensive efforts or additional team members to meet the target.
Whether you opt for in-house developers, freelancers, or outsourcing agencies influences the cost and scope of services. Agencies often provide comprehensive solutions, while freelancers and in-house teams may offer specific expertise. The development approach can shape the efficiency and scalability of the project.
UK mobile app developers are known for their technical proficiency and exposure to global trends. However, their services typically reflect the high cost of living and the city’s status as a tech hub. Exploring remote options may help optimize costs while maintaining quality standards.
Post-launch support, including updates, troubleshooting, and feature enhancements, is essential for keeping the app functional and competitive. These ongoing services can either be included in the initial development agreement or provided as a separate offering.
A seamless and visually appealing design enhances user satisfaction and engagement. Mobile application developers uk with UI/UX expertise or collaboration with dedicated designers focus on creating intuitive interfaces, which can significantly contribute to the app’s overall success.
Incorporating advanced mobile app security measures, such as data encryption, secure authentication, and compliance with global standards, is crucial for protecting user information and building trust. The implementation of robust security protocols requires specialized skills and attention to detail.
Third-party apps or services integration demands experts’ attention. For example, a few factors for integrating payment gateways require the assistance of skilled and experienced resources. Seamless compatibility with these services enhances app functionality and user experience.
To excel in London’s competitive mobile app development market, developers must have a well-rounded skill set that balances technical expertise, creativity, and adaptability. Below are detailed insights into the key skills needed to find the right mobile app developer in the UK.
Expertise in programming languages like Swift and Objective-C for iOS, Kotlin for Android app development, and Java for Android is a non-negotiable requirement to hire mobile app developers in the UK. These languages form the backbone of high-performance native applications.
Additionally, familiarity with languages like Dart (for Flutter app development) or JavaScript (for React Native App Development) expands developers’ versatility in creating cross-platform apps. Developers must also keep up with updates and new features in these languages to maintain coding efficiency and compatibility.
Cross-platform frameworks like Flutter and React Native empower the best Mobile App developers in the United Kingdom to create apps that function seamlessly across iOS and Android using a single codebase. This approach significantly reduces development time and cost while maintaining quality.
Proficiency in cross-platform tools demonstrates the developer’s ability to adapt to modern trends, making them more resource-efficient for businesses. With cross-platform development, updates or fixes can be deployed simultaneously across platforms, ensuring faster time-to-market and consistent user experiences.
Top app developers in the UK have strong UI/UX design knowledge to avoid common UIUX mistakes in app development and craft visually compelling and highly functional interfaces. This includes understanding color theory, typography, and user journey mapping to optimize the app’s usability. London mobile app developers must collaborate with designers or independently create interfaces that enhance engagement, retention, and user satisfaction.
Optimizing your on-demand app performance ensures the app operates smoothly, even under heavy usage. To hire mobile app developers in the UK, it’s essential to ensure they master techniques such as lazy loading, minimizing API calls, and efficient memory management to optimize app performance. Tools like Crashlytics, New Relic, or Firebase Performance Monitoring help track and resolve performance bottlenecks.
Also Read: Tips and Best Practices on Optimization of Android App Development
Mobile apps’ performance often depends on app backend development to deliver data or process transactions. For seamless data flow, developers must proficiently integrate RESTful APIs, GraphQL, and other backend systems. Knowledge of authentication protocols like OAuth and JWT adds an extra layer of security while enhancing functionality.
Cloud technologies like AWS, Azure, and Google Cloud have revolutionized app development by enabling scalable storage, real-time analytics, and global delivery. Developers are proficient in cloud deployment and management for cloud-based app development that handles large-scale data while maintaining optimal performance.
Version control tools like Git, GitHub, or Bitbucket are essential for team-based app development. They enable developers to track changes, collaborate with other team members, and revert to previous code versions when necessary. Mastery of branching, merging, and resolving conflicts is crucial for smooth project workflows.
Skilled London mobile app developers are adept at deploying the industry’s best mobile app testing strategies to identify bugs and ensure a flawless user experience. Familiarity with testing frameworks like JUnit, Appium, or XCTest allows the best mobile app developers in the United Kingdom to automate tests for faster and more accurate results.
Debugging involves tools like ADB (Android Debug Bridge) or Xcode Debugger to troubleshoot issues effectively. Thorough testing minimizes the risk of negative reviews due to crashes or poor functionality, boosting app credibility.
With increasing cybersecurity concerns, App Creator UK must prioritize security at every stage of development. This includes implementing data encryption technology, two-factor authentication (2FA), a multi-factor authentication system, and secure coding practices to protect user data. Awareness of regulations like GDPR ensures compliance and builds user trust, and it is crucial when you hire an app developer in the UK.
Agile scrum methodologies in mobile app development are vital for app creators in the UK working in dynamic project environments. Agile enables iterative development, allowing teams to adapt to feedback and make improvements in real-time.
Developers skilled in Agile foster collaboration, transparency, and efficiency throughout the development cycle, making them ideal when you hire an app developer in the UK.
To ensure a smooth launch, developers must be well-versed in App Store and Google Play guidelines, including design, content, and functionality requirements. Non-compliance can lead to rejection, delays, or even app removal. Developers must also stay updated on policy changes to maintain app availability.
When you hire mobile app developers in London, UK, you face unique challenges due to the city’s competitive tech landscape and diverse talent pool.
However, strategic solutions can address each challenge to ensure the right talent is hired for your app development needs. Let’s understand!
Challenge: The tech industry in London is booming, leading to a high demand for skilled developers. This makes it challenging to secure top talent, as multiple companies often approach them simultaneously.
Solution: To attract the best developers, offer competitive compensation packages, flexible working arrangements, and opportunities for professional growth. Clearly define your company’s unique value proposition, such as working on innovative projects or fostering a collaborative work environment, to stand out in the crowded market.
Challenge: With developers specializing in various fields, such as iOS, Android, or cross-platform development, finding the right skill set for your specific project can be overwhelming.
Solution: Clearly define your project requirements and the technical skills needed. Use these criteria to narrow your search and prioritize candidates with relevant experience. Partnering with a recruitment agency or outsourcing to a development firm with specialized teams can streamline this process.
Challenge: When you hire mobile app developers in London, UK, the costs can be high due to recruitment agency fees, advertising expenses, and the typically high salaries expected in London.
Solution: Consider cost-effective alternatives like outsourcing to reputable app development agencies that offer flexible pricing models. These agencies often provide end-to-end services, reducing the need for multiple hires and lowering overall costs when you hire mobile app developers in the UK.
Challenge: London’s tech scene is highly competitive, and developers frequently switch jobs for better opportunities, leaving companies struggling with high turnover rates.
Solution: Focus on creating a strong company culture prioritizing employee satisfaction and career development. Offer perks such as training programs, team-building activities, and performance-based incentives to retain top talent. Regularly engage with your team to ensure they feel valued and aligned with company goals.
Challenge: While hiring locally can provide better communication and cultural alignment, it may limit access to a broader talent pool. On the other hand, relying solely on remote developers can lead to communication and collaboration challenges.
Solution: Adopt a hybrid hiring model that combines local and remote talent. For critical roles requiring close collaboration, prioritize local hires. For specialized tasks or scaling needs, consider remote developers or outsourcing to experienced firms that seamlessly integrate with your team.
Partnering with mobile app developers in London provides unparalleled advantages, including access to top-tier technical expertise and a deep understanding of the local market. Their familiarity with UK consumer preferences and compliance standards ensures your app resonates with users while adhering to regulations. Let’s explore these advantages in more detail.
London is a global tech hub, home to a diverse pool of highly skilled mobile app developers. With experience spanning various industries and technologies, developers in London bring innovative thinking and technical expertise to deliver exceptional solutions for businesses.
Mobile app developers in London possess in-depth knowledge of the UK market, consumer preferences, and cultural nuances. This understanding ensures they can design apps that resonate with the local audience, enhancing user engagement and satisfaction.
Working with developers in London offers the advantage of being in the same time zone, enabling seamless collaboration. Regular in-person meetings and instant communication foster a more cohesive development process, reducing delays and misunderstandings.
London developers are well-versed in GDPR and other UK-specific regulations, ensuring your app meets all necessary compliance standards. This expertise helps businesses avoid legal complications and prioritizes data security and user privacy.
As a thriving innovation hub, London’s tech ecosystem fosters cutting-edge solutions and creativity. UK mobile app developers are often exposed to the latest trends and technologies, enabling them to create apps that stand out in competitive markets.
London-based developers typically employ robust project management methodologies like Agile or Scrum, ensuring timely delivery without compromising quality. Their focus on efficient workflows helps businesses meet tight deadlines while achieving desired outcomes, making hiring mobile app developers in the UK easier.
Beyond development, London app developers offer comprehensive post-launch mobile app maintenance tailored to address the unique needs of UK businesses. Whether it’s updates, bug fixes, or feature enhancements, their ongoing assistance ensures your app remains competitive.
Appinventiv is the ideal mobile app development company in the UK, known for its commitment to delivering innovative and scalable app solutions.
With a team of highly skilled developers, designers, and strategists, they ensure that every project is approached with expertise and a customer-first mentality.
Whether you’re looking to hire mobile app developers in the UK or need a full-service development partner, Appinventiv brings a deep understanding of the latest technologies and industry trends, ensuring your app is future-ready and aligned with user expectations.
The benefits of hiring mobile app developers in the UK with Appinventiv include access to cutting-edge solutions, adherence to compliance standards, and seamless communication.
Connect with us as we collaborate to craft a world-class app tailored to your needs.
Q. How do you hire an app development company in the UK?
A. To understand how to hire an app development company in the UK, clearly define your project’s requirements and goals. Research potential companies by evaluating their portfolios, client testimonials, and industry reputation. Choosing a company that specializes in your type of app and offers comprehensive services, including design, development, and post-launch support, is important. Ensure the company is proficient in modern development frameworks, follows agile methodologies, and can meet your budget and timeline. Effective communication from the outset is crucial to ensure the app development company understands your vision and expectations.
Q. What are the latest UK mobile app development trends?
A. The UK mobile app development trends are constantly evolving and driven by technological advancements and changing consumer needs. Key trends include the rise of machine learning deployment, harnessing AI for businesses to deliver personalized user experiences, cross-platform app development, and the integration of augmented reality (AR) and virtual reality (VR) in various industries. Additionally, there is an increasing focus on mobile app security, data privacy, and the adoption of cloud technologies. These trends reflect the growing demand for more sophisticated, user-centric, and secure mobile applications in the UK market.
Q. What is the cost to hire an app developer in the UK?
A. The cost to hire an app developer in the UK can range between $40,000 to $300,000, depending on factors such as the app’s complexity, the platform (iOS or Android), and the required features. The developer’s experience level and the project timeline also play a significant role in determining the cost. You might be looking at the lower end of this range for more basic apps, while more complex, feature-rich applications could push the cost toward the higher end. It’s important to clearly define your app’s requirements to get a more accurate estimate.
B-25, Sector 58,
Noida- 201301,
Delhi - NCR, India
Suite 3810, Bankers Hall West,
888 - 3rd Street Sw
Calgary Alberta